Bhopal, May 31 (IANS). Prime Minister Narendra Modi attended the 300th birthday program of Ahilyabai Holkar on Saturday, held at Jamboree Maidan in Bhopal and paid tribute to him. During his speech, the prime minister remembered the contribution of Ahilyabai. Prime Minister Narendra Modi said: “Lokmata Ahilyabai was a great patron of the cultural heritage of India. 250-300 years ago, when the country was caught in the chains of slavery, his temples and pilgrimages across the country, including Kashi Vishwanath, rebuilt.
